Thanks guys.

@MasterSlowPoke - The disk is a cheap broach I got from Michael's. I have 2 more in production that will be similar but with more detail for my heralds.

@Cutthroatcure - I sculpted the spore using a wooden goose egg (again from Michael's) and some Procreate. I then made a mold so I could crank out a few copies. The base is from a Pegasus Hobbies crater.
